Suicide is the 2nd leading cause of death among college students.
Suicide is the 3rd leading cause of death among all those 15-24 years old.
Suicide is the 4th leading cause of death among all those 10-14 years old.
The suicide rate for white males (15-24) has tripled since 1950 while for white females (15-24) it has more than doubled.
The suicide rate for all children (10-14) has more than doubled over the last 15 years.
The suicide rate for young black males (15-24) has risen by 2/3 in only the past 15 years.
Adolescent males commit suicide more than adolescent females by a ratio of 5:1.
Characteristics of Youth at Risk for Suicide
Mental Illness- 90% of adolescent suicide victims have at least one
diagnosable, active psychiatric illness at the time of death--most
often depression, substance abuse, and conduct disorders. Only 33-
50% of suicide victims were identified by their doctors as having a
mental illness at the time of their death, and only 15% were in
treatment at the time of death.
Previous Attempts- 26-33% of adolescent suicide victims have made a previous suicide attempt.
Firearms- Having a firearm in the home greatly increases the risk of youth suicide. 64% of suicide victims 10-24 years old use a firearm to complete the act.
Stressors- Suicide in youth often occurs after the victim has gotten into some sort of trouble or has experienced recent disappointment and rejection.
Preventing Youth Suicide
Prevention should include social policy that limits access to
firearms, alcohol, and illicit substances, as well as responsible
portrayal and coverage of suicide in the media.
Another necessary component of prevention is the identification of potentially suicidal adolescents. Once potentially suicidal individuals have been identified, emphasis should be placed on seeking professional help, which should include intensive treatment of any underlying mental illness.
